What kind of horsepower does a 2011 Ford F-350 have?
What kind of horsepower does a 2011 Ford F-350 have?
Ford won’t say what the final power figures are for its new 2011 engines, though we have heard that the 6.7-liter PSD will make more than 390 horsepower and 720 pounds-feet of torque. The 6.2-liter V-8 is expected to pump out approximately 400 hp and 400 pounds-feet of torque.

What kind of engine does the Ford F-250 Super Duty have?
The Ford F-250 Super Duty has been redesigned for 2011, with new exterior styling, new gas and diesel engines, a six-speed automatic transmission, and many new standard and optional features. Buyers of the 2011 Ford F-250 Super Duty are given the choice of either a 6.2-liter gasoline V8 or an optional 6.7-liter diesel-fueled V8.

What kind of truck is Ford Super Duty?
Super Duty trucks are ideal for towing and hauling, and a host of new features such as Hill Ascent and Hill Descent Control, make the task even easier, while giving drivers added piece of mind. The 2011 Super Duty F-350 is the largest Ford pickup available with a single rear-wheel configuration.
